引言
在当今互联网时代,数据的安全性和隐私性变得愈发重要。V2Ray作为一种强大的代理工具,广泛应用于科学上网和数据加密传输中。本文将深入探讨V2Ray的数据解密技术,帮助读者更好地理解其工作原理和应用场景。
什么是V2Ray?
V2Ray是一个开源的网络代理工具,旨在帮助用户绕过网络限制,保护用户的隐私。它支持多种协议和传输方式,具有高度的灵活性和可配置性。
V2Ray的主要功能
- 多协议支持:V2Ray支持VMess、Shadowsocks、Socks等多种协议。
- 动态路由:可以根据不同的需求动态选择路由。
- 数据加密:通过加密技术保护用户数据的安全。
V2Ray的数据解密原理
V2Ray的数据解密主要依赖于其内置的加密算法和协议。以下是一些关键点:
加密算法
V2Ray使用多种加密算法来保护数据传输的安全性,包括但不限于:
- AES:高级加密标准,广泛应用于数据加密。
- ChaCha20:一种流加密算法,速度快且安全性高。
数据包结构
V2Ray的数据包结构复杂,包含了多种信息,如:
- 头部信息:包含协议类型、版本号等。
- 负载数据:实际传输的数据内容。
V2Ray数据解密的步骤
解密V2Ray数据的过程可以分为以下几个步骤:
- 捕获数据包:使用网络抓包工具捕获V2Ray传输的数据包。
- 分析数据包:解析数据包的头部信息,确定使用的协议和加密方式。
- 解密数据:根据协议和加密算法,使用相应的密钥进行解密。
V2Ray数据解密的应用场景
- 网络安全研究:帮助研究人员分析网络流量,发现潜在的安全隐患。
- 数据恢复:在数据丢失或损坏的情况下,尝试恢复重要信息。
- 教育和学习:帮助学生和研究者理解网络协议和加密技术。
常见问题解答(FAQ)
V2Ray数据解密是否合法?
解密V2Ray数据的合法性取决于具体的使用场景和当地法律。在某些情况下,解密他人数据可能违反法律法规。
如何确保V2Ray的安全性?
- 定期更新:保持V2Ray软件的最新版本,以修复已知漏洞。
- 使用强密码:确保使用强密码和密钥来保护数据传输。
V2Ray与其他代理工具的比较
- 灵活性:V2Ray支持更多的协议和配置选项。
- 性能:在高延迟网络环境下,V2Ray表现更佳。
结论
V2Ray作为一种强大的网络代理工具,其数据解密技术在网络安全和隐私保护中发挥着重要作用。通过深入理解V2Ray的数据解密原理和应用场景,用户可以更好地利用这一工具,保护自己的网络安全。
正文完